Scope and content
1 Evan Stephens of Llansaint in the parish of St Ishmael, co. Carmarthen and Eleanor his wife. 2 John Mirehouse of Inner Temple London and Elizabeth Mirehouse of Peterborough, co. Northampton, spinster. 3 William Bell of Bow Church Ward, London and Rhys Beynon Roch Prytherch of the town of Carmarthen and Edward Leach of Furnivals, London. Smith v Young. Settlement of the fortune of Mrs Eleanor Stephens and property in Bridge Street, Carmarthen. (Attested copy). Formerly NLW Croydon Deeds 154.
